Initial Inspection and Diagnostic Overview

Combination Meter System

INSPECTION

1. SELF-DIAGNOSIS
The self-diagnosis (checking of each meter, warning light, indicator, illumination, LCD, buzzer sound) of combination meter can be performed in the following procedure.

1. Turn the ignition switch to ON while turning the small light to OFF.
2. Step 1.Turn the small light switch to ON within 3 seconds after step 1), then press the odo/tripmeter knob three times.
3. Turn the small light switch to OFF, and press the odo/trip knob three times.
4. Turn the small light switch to ON, and press the odo/trip knob three times.

NOTE:
- Perform the steps described in 2. and 4. within 10 seconds after the ignition switch is turned to ON.
- When pressing the odo/trip meter knob four times, the display changes to DTC display mode (ECM, TCM). When the self-diagnosis function operates, the warning light, indicator, and LCD display are checked, then every press of the odo/trip meter knob will initiate the operation checks in the order of meter, illumination and buzzer. Turn the ignition switch to OFF to cancel the self-diagnosis function.
- When the engine starts during diagnosis, the self-diagnosis function is not cancelled, however, once the vehicle starts driving, the self-diagnosis function is cancelled automatically for safety.

CAUTION: When measuring the voltage and resistance of each control module or sensor, use a tapered pin with a diameter of less than 0.64 mm (0.025 in) in order to avoid poor contact. Do not insert the pin more than 2 mm (0.08 in).
